When’s the Best Time to Go?
The best time to visit Thong Sala is during the dry season (November to April), when the weather is sunny and warm. The shoulder seasons (May and October) offer a good balance of pleasant weather and fewer crowds. The wet season (May to October) can bring heavy rain, but also lush greenery and lower prices.
Transportation Options in Thong Sala, Thailand
Getting around Thong Sala is easy. Walking is a great way to explore the town centre. Songthaews (shared taxis) and motorbike taxis are readily available for longer distances. Shopping Highlights
The Thong Sala Night Market is a shopper's paradise, offering a wide range of local crafts, clothing, and souvenirs. You can find everything from handmade jewellery to vibrant textiles. Don't be afraid to haggle for a good deal!
